Language studies on Campus

On-campus language study programmes cover a wide range of situations.
For example, a summer language study programme for children or teenagers allows young people to live, study and do activities on the same site. This could be a university campus or a public school campus. For students, a language study programme on campus means that you can take courses on the campus of a university abroad and, if necessary, stay in the campus residence, but sometimes students can choose accommodation off the university campus.
There are also language study programmes on campus for adults during the summer, with courses and accommodation on the university campus.
Some language study programmes are offered at universities to enable students to take courses that are not language courses but specialised courses (art, architecture, fashion design, business, etc.). These language study programmes are reserved for people with a more advanced level of language.

Summer campus programme for Teenagers

Camp d’été Bella Italia pour adolescents

This program is perfect for teens. It offers teens the opportunity to discover a campus lifestyle abroad for the summer.

During summer, university students give up their place and allow teens to be accommodated and take advantage of the facilities on a campus.
Courses take place on the campus.
Students will live in an international atmosphere with the other young people from the whole world.

The program includes:

  • Accommodation on the campus
  • Language lessons
  • Books and materials
  • Afternoon or evening activities, and if specified, weekend excursions

The activities program may change depending on the particular campus.
Teenagers are not supervised 24 hours a day and will have a lot of free time.

Minimum level required: Elementary
